AllocData() | PsdSignalFitting::PronyFitter | private |
CalcSignalBegin(float front_time_beg_03, float front_time_end) | PsdSignalFitting::PronyFitter | |
CalculateFitAmplitudes() | PsdSignalFitting::PronyFitter | |
CalculateFitHarmonics() | PsdSignalFitting::PronyFitter | |
ChooseBestSignalBegin(int first_sample, int last_sample) | PsdSignalFitting::PronyFitter | |
ChooseBestSignalBeginHarmonics(int first_sample, int last_sample) | PsdSignalFitting::PronyFitter | |
Clear() | PsdSignalFitting::PronyFitter | private |
CovarianceDirect(float &rho_f, std::vector< float > &a_f, float &rho_b, std::vector< float > &a_b) | PsdSignalFitting::PronyFitter | |
CovarianceQRmod(float &rho_f, std::vector< float > &a_f, float &rho_b, std::vector< float > &a_b) | PsdSignalFitting::PronyFitter | |
DeleteData() | PsdSignalFitting::PronyFitter | private |
fExpNumber | PsdSignalFitting::PronyFitter | private |
fGateBeg | PsdSignalFitting::PronyFitter | private |
fGateEnd | PsdSignalFitting::PronyFitter | private |
fh | PsdSignalFitting::PronyFitter | private |
fIsDebug | PsdSignalFitting::PronyFitter | private |
fModelOrder | PsdSignalFitting::PronyFitter | private |
fSampleTotal | PsdSignalFitting::PronyFitter | private |
fSignalBegin | PsdSignalFitting::PronyFitter | private |
fTotalPolRoots | PsdSignalFitting::PronyFitter | private |
fuFitWfm | PsdSignalFitting::PronyFitter | private |
fuFitZeroLevel | PsdSignalFitting::PronyFitter | private |
fuWfm | PsdSignalFitting::PronyFitter | private |
fuZeroLevel | PsdSignalFitting::PronyFitter | private |
fz | PsdSignalFitting::PronyFitter | private |
GetAmplitudes() | PsdSignalFitting::PronyFitter | |
GetChiSquare(int gate_beg, int gate_end, int time_max) | PsdSignalFitting::PronyFitter | |
GetDeltaInSample(int sample) | PsdSignalFitting::PronyFitter | |
GetFitValue(int sample_number) | PsdSignalFitting::PronyFitter | |
GetFitValue(float x) | PsdSignalFitting::PronyFitter | |
GetFitWfm() | PsdSignalFitting::PronyFitter | inline |
GetHarmonics() | PsdSignalFitting::PronyFitter | |
GetIntegral(int gate_beg, int gate_end) | PsdSignalFitting::PronyFitter | |
GetMaxAmplitude() | PsdSignalFitting::PronyFitter | |
GetNumberPolRoots() | PsdSignalFitting::PronyFitter | |
GetRSquare(int gate_beg, int gate_end) | PsdSignalFitting::PronyFitter | |
GetRSquareSignal() | PsdSignalFitting::PronyFitter | |
GetSignalBeginFromPhase() | PsdSignalFitting::PronyFitter | |
GetSignalMaxTime() | PsdSignalFitting::PronyFitter | |
GetX(float level, int first_sample, int last_sample) | PsdSignalFitting::PronyFitter | |
GetX(float level, int first_sample, int last_sample, float step) | PsdSignalFitting::PronyFitter | |
GetZeroLevel() | PsdSignalFitting::PronyFitter | |
Initialize(int model_order, int exponent_number, int gate_beg, int gate_end) | PsdSignalFitting::PronyFitter | private |
LevelBy2Points(float X1, float Y1, float X2, float Y2, float Y0) | PsdSignalFitting::PronyFitter | |
MakePileUpRejection(int time_max) | PsdSignalFitting::PronyFitter | |
PronyFitter() | PsdSignalFitting::PronyFitter | inline |
PronyFitter(int model_order, int exponent_number, int gate_beg, int gate_end) | PsdSignalFitting::PronyFitter | |
SetDebugMode(bool IsDebug) | PsdSignalFitting::PronyFitter | inline |
SetExternalHarmonics(std::complex< float > z1, std::complex< float > z2) | PsdSignalFitting::PronyFitter | |
SetHarmonics(std::complex< float > *z) | PsdSignalFitting::PronyFitter | |
SetSignalBegin(int SignalBeg) | PsdSignalFitting::PronyFitter | |
SetWaveform(std::vector< uint16_t > &uWfm, uint16_t uZeroLevel) | PsdSignalFitting::PronyFitter | |
SolveSLECholesky(float *x, float **a, float *b, int n) | PsdSignalFitting::PronyFitter | |
SolveSLEGauss(float *x, float **r, float *b, int n) | PsdSignalFitting::PronyFitter | |
SolveSLEGauss(std::complex< float > *x, std::complex< float > **r, std::complex< float > *b, int n) | PsdSignalFitting::PronyFitter | |
~PronyFitter() | PsdSignalFitting::PronyFitter | inline |